+       /**
+        * Reset mw.config and others to a fresh copy of the live config for each test(),
+        * and restore it back to the live one afterwards.
+        *
+        * @param {Object} [localEnv]
+        * @example (see test suite at the bottom of this file)
+        * </code>
+        */
+       QUnit.newMwEnvironment = ( function () {
+               var warn, error, liveConfig, liveMessages,
+                       MwMap = mw.config.constructor, // internal use only
+                       ajaxRequests = [];
+
+               liveConfig = mw.config;
+               liveMessages = mw.messages;
+
+               function suppressWarnings() {
+                       if ( warn === undefined ) {
+                               warn = mw.log.warn;
+                               error = mw.log.error;
+                               mw.log.warn = mw.log.error = $.noop;
+                       }
+               }
+
+               function restoreWarnings() {
+                       // Guard against calls not balanced with suppressWarnings()
+                       if ( warn !== undefined ) {
+                               mw.log.warn = warn;
+                               mw.log.error = error;
+                               warn = error = undefined;
+                       }
+               }
+
+               function freshConfigCopy( custom ) {
+                       var copy;
+                       // Tests should mock all factors that directly influence the tested code.
+                       // For backwards compatibility though we set mw.config to a fresh copy of the live
+                       // config. This way any modifications made to mw.config during the test will not
+                       // affect other tests, nor the global scope outside the test runner.
+                       // This is a shallow copy, since overriding an array or object value via "custom"
+                       // should replace it. Setting a config property means you override it, not extend it.
+                       // NOTE: It is important that we suppress warnings because extend() will also access
+                       // deprecated properties and trigger deprecation warnings from mw.log#deprecate.
+                       suppressWarnings();
+                       copy = $.extend( {}, liveConfig.get(), custom );
+                       restoreWarnings();
+
+                       return copy;
+               }
+
+               function freshMessagesCopy( custom ) {
+                       return $.extend( /* deep */true, {}, liveMessages.get(), custom );
+               }
+
+               /**
+                * @param {jQuery.Event} event
+                * @param {jqXHR} jqXHR
+                * @param {Object} ajaxOptions
+                */
+               function trackAjax( event, jqXHR, ajaxOptions ) {
+                       ajaxRequests.push( { xhr: jqXHR, options: ajaxOptions } );
+               }
+
+               return function ( orgEnv ) {
+                       var localEnv = orgEnv ? makeSafeEnv( orgEnv ) : {};
+                       // MediaWiki env testing
+                       localEnv.config = orgEnv && orgEnv.config || {};
+                       localEnv.messages = orgEnv && orgEnv.messages || {};
+
+                       return {
+                               beforeEach: function () {
+                                       // Greetings, mock environment!
+                                       mw.config = new MwMap();
+                                       mw.config.set( freshConfigCopy( localEnv.config ) );
+                                       mw.messages = new MwMap();
+                                       mw.messages.set( freshMessagesCopy( localEnv.messages ) );
+                                       // Update reference to mw.messages
+                                       mw.jqueryMsg.setParserDefaults( {
+                                               messages: mw.messages
+                                       } );
+
+                                       this.suppressWarnings = suppressWarnings;
+                                       this.restoreWarnings = restoreWarnings;
+
+                                       // Start tracking ajax requests
+                                       $( document ).on( 'ajaxSend', trackAjax );
+
+                                       if ( localEnv.beforeEach ) {
+                                               return localEnv.beforeEach.apply( this, arguments );
+                                       }
+                               },
+
+                               afterEach: function () {
+                                       var timers, pending, $activeLen, ret;
+
+                                       if ( localEnv.afterEach ) {
+                                               ret = localEnv.afterEach.apply( this, arguments );
+                                       }
+
+                                       // Stop tracking ajax requests
+                                       $( document ).off( 'ajaxSend', trackAjax );
+
+                                       // As a convenience feature, automatically restore warnings if they're
+                                       // still suppressed by the end of the test.
+                                       restoreWarnings();
+
+                                       // Farewell, mock environment!
+                                       mw.config = liveConfig;
+                                       mw.messages = liveMessages;
+                                       // Restore reference to mw.messages
+                                       mw.jqueryMsg.setParserDefaults( {
+                                               messages: liveMessages
+                                       } );
+
+                                       // Tests should use fake timers or wait for animations to complete
+                                       // Check for incomplete animations/requests/etc and throw if there are any.
+                                       if ( $.timers && $.timers.length !== 0 ) {
+                                               timers = $.timers.length;
+                                               $.each( $.timers, function ( i, timer ) {
+                                                       var node = timer.elem;
+                                                       mw.log.warn( 'Unfinished animation #' + i + ' in ' + timer.queue + ' queue on ' +
+                                                               mw.html.element( node.nodeName.toLowerCase(), $( node ).getAttrs() )
+                                                       );
+                                               } );
+                                               // Force animations to stop to give the next test a clean start
+                                               $.timers = [];
+                                               $.fx.stop();
+
+                                               throw new Error( 'Unfinished animations: ' + timers );
+                                       }
+
+                                       // Test should use fake XHR, wait for requests, or call abort()
+                                       $activeLen = $.active;
+                                       if ( $activeLen !== undefined && $activeLen !== 0 ) {
+                                               pending = $.grep( ajaxRequests, function ( ajax ) {
+                                                       return ajax.xhr.state() === 'pending';
+                                               } );
+                                               if ( pending.length !== $activeLen ) {
+                                                       mw.log.warn( 'Pending requests does not match jQuery.active count' );
+                                               }
+                                               // Force requests to stop to give the next test a clean start
+                                               $.each( ajaxRequests, function ( i, ajax ) {
+                                                       mw.log.warn(
+                                                               'AJAX request #' + i + ' (state: ' + ajax.xhr.state() + ')',
+                                                               ajax.options
+                                                       );
+                                                       ajax.xhr.abort();
+                                               } );
+                                               ajaxRequests = [];
+
+                                               throw new Error( 'Pending AJAX requests: ' + pending.length + ' (active: ' + $activeLen + ')' );
+                                       }
+
+                                       return ret;
+                               }
+                       };
+               };
+       }() );

+       // $.when stops as soon as one fails, which makes sense in most
+       // practical scenarios, but not in a unit test where we really do
+       // need to wait until all of them are finished.
+       QUnit.whenPromisesComplete = function () {
+               var altPromises = [];
+
+               $.each( arguments, function ( i, arg ) {
+                       var alt = $.Deferred();
+                       altPromises.push( alt );
+
+                       // Whether this one fails or not, forwards it to
+                       // the 'done' (resolve) callback of the alternative promise.
+                       arg.always( alt.resolve );
+               } );
+
+               return $.when.apply( $, altPromises );
+       };
